Andrew Cuomo: A Legacy in Question



Andrew Cuomo, the former governor of New York, was once a beloved figure in American politics, praised for his leadership during the COVID-19 pandemic. However, in recent months, Cuomo has been embroiled in a scandal that has called his legacy into question.


In March 2021, multiple women came forward accusing Cuomo of sexual harassment and misconduct. The allegations ranged from unwanted touching to inappropriate comments and advances. Initially, Cuomo denied any wrongdoing and dismissed the accusations as politically motivated. However, as more allegations emerged, pressure began to mount on the governor to step down.


In August 2021, after a months-long investigation by the New York attorney general's office, a report was released that found Cuomo had sexually harassed multiple women and created a hostile work environment. The report was a devastating blow to Cuomo's reputation, and it prompted widespread calls for his resignation. Even President Joe Biden, a longtime friend of Cuomo, called on him to step down.


Cuomo initially refused to resign, but as the pressure continued to mount, he eventually announced his resignation in August 2021. His resignation marked the end of a long and controversial political career, which included three terms as governor of New York, and a brief stint as Secretary of Housing and Urban Development under President Bill Clinton.


Despite his initial popularity, Cuomo's downfall has left many questioning his legacy. While he was praised for his leadership during the COVID-19 pandemic, his handling of the crisis has come under scrutiny. Cuomo was criticized for underreporting nursing home deaths, and his administration's handling of vaccine distribution was also called into question.


Cuomo's legacy will forever be marred by the sexual harassment allegations and the subsequent investigation. Many of his former supporters have turned on him, and his future in politics remains uncertain.
